    iTunes does not have provision for automatically storing one kind of media on a separate drive, so you have some basic decisions to make first.  Do you want these movies to still appear in your iTunes library, or are you content with browsing filenames on a drive in Finder when you want to look for one?  The second's the easiest thing because then you don't have to have an external drive permanently turned on and attached to your computer (wired or wireless).  To do that you literelly only need to drag your movies folder to an archive drive and delete movies from iTunes.  To watch them again you can add it back to iTunes while holding down the option key so the movie is used from its location on the external drive.
    There's ways to move the movies to an external drive while keeping them in iTunes but the external drive iwll always have to be turned on and connected to the computer or you will see a bunch of broken link exclamation marks.
    Realize what you are talking about is not "backup".  Backup (which you should do) is putting a second or more copy of items on external drives for the day when your internal drive fails and everything on it is lost, inclduing all your home photos and perhaps things that have been pulled from the iTunes Store and can no longer be re-downloaded.

    Have you tried starting up with your install disk and doing a disk repair?
    Put the install disk that came with the Mac in the DVD/CD drive and restart holding down the 'C' key. You can take your finger off once you hear it making noises from the DVD/CD drive. You'll be presented with a screen where you choose your language. At the next screen on the menu bar select Utilities>Disk Utility you then select your Macintosh HD on the left and click on 'repair disk'. If it makes any changes click on 'repair disk' again and repeat the process until you get a clean pass. Once done select restart from the Apple menu and hopefully the Mac will boot normally.

    What to do if the installer warns that no Recovery HD can be created
    Some disk partition configurations may result in the OS X Lion installer reporting that it could not create a Recovery HD. In these situations, even if you are permitted to continue the install, you should quit the install and create an external, bootable OS X Lion hard drive with a Recovery HD, first. You will be able to return to the upgrade to OS X Lion on your computer's boot drive after creating the external Recovery HD.
    Important notes
    Your storage device must have at least 13 GB available (after formatting) to install Lion and an Internet Restore partition.
    These steps will erase and reformat the storage device. This article will instruct you on setting up the storage device to use the GUID partition scheme and the Mac OS Extended (Journaled) format, which are required to install Lion and an Internet Restore partition on your external storage device. You should back up any important files that are on the device to a different drive.
    This procedure will install a version of the OS X Lion that is compatible with the Mac it was created with. Using this Lion system with a different kind of Mac may produce unpredictable results.
    Your computer's serial number will be sent to Apple to help authenticate your request to download and install OS X Lion.

  • HT201210 Just updates itunes software on my windows PC and now it won't open because of Runtime error R6034 can you help?

    Just updated itunes software on my windows PC and now it won't open because of Runtime error R6034 can you help?

    Go to Control Panel > Add or Remove Programs (Win XP) or Programs and Features (later)
    Remove all of these items in the following order:
    iTunes
    Apple Software Update
    Apple Mobile Device Support (if this won't uninstall move on to the next item)
    Bonjour
    Apple Application Support
    Reboot, download iTunes, then reinstall, either using an account with administrative rights, or right-clicking the downloaded installer and selecting Run as Administrator.
    The uninstall and reinstall process will preserve your iTunes library and settings, but ideally you would back up the library and your other important personal documents and data on a regular basis. See this user tip for a suggested technique.
    Please note:
    Some users may need to follow all the steps in whichever of the following support documents applies to their system. These include some additional manual file and folder deletions not mentioned above.
    HT1925: Removing and Reinstalling iTunes for Windows XP
    HT1923: Removing and reinstalling iTunes for Windows Vista, Windows 7, or Windows 8

    For moving your iTunes library, I recommend this method...
    Assuming you use the iTunes default settings where iTunes copied added items to your iTunes folder and organizes your library (meaning - everything is all self contained in the iTunes folder), then all you have to do is drag & drop your iTunes folder (not just the iTunes Music folder you find inside the iTunes folder) to the external drive and copy the entire thing.
    If you want to test that it worked or would like to actually start using it from that location instead, use these instructions when you start iTunes to point it to the new location...
    How to open an alternate iTunes Library file or create a new one
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=304447
    If you are just testing, then close iTunes after you verify it works, and restart iTunes again with the same instructions and point it back to your internal drive (original) location.
